Trochut is a geometric display typeface developed by Andreu Balius as an homage to Joan Trochut Blanchart, drawing inspiration from the Bisonte type specimen. It features Regular, Italic, and Bold styles, crafted for use in magazines, posters, book jackets, and other display contexts on the web. Its distinctive and playful design lends itself well to eye-catching headlines and creative editorial layouts.

Designer: Andreu Balius
